Plus:
The unit cools well. It is small and easy to move. Minus: The dehumidifier is fairly noisy and it runs when the unit is in dehumidifier mode or in air conditioner mode. The compressor (which only runs in air conditioning mode) is very quiet as is the fan. I would not use this unit in a bedroom. Installing the exhaust hose was a bit difficult as the hose did not have any end coverings and was a tight fit into the widow and air conditioner connectors. The window slider kit is easy to install but the height is too small. The slider is only a little bit bigger that the opening for the window exhaust adapter. With the adapter in the slider does not sit on the bottom of the window frame. In my window there is a half-inch gap between the bottom of the slider and the bottom of the window frame that has to be filled in. BTW, the instructions for removing the unit from the packaging material and box require you to destroy both so there isn't any way to repack the unit if you need to ship it back.

By 1. If it's over 90 degrees outside, it will not cool off a medium room fast enough. 2. Window kit required modification. 3. In humid climates, water does not evaporate fast enough. It drips into a very small reservoir which fills up every single hour. The spout at the bottom in the back is hard to reach and drain if unit is resting on the ground. The included drip pan is a joke. This thing leaks uncontrollably, causing a bad odor in your carpet. I had to elevate my unit off the ground so it will drip into a large bucket. You will be waking up every hour due to the reservoir filling up and the compressor stopping, and room temperature rising causing discomfort. I tried to return the product but was just past the 30 day return policy. I will not buy another Soleus product again. If you need something other than a spot cooler, you may want to consider something above 7,000 BTU (you can find higher BTU coolers for close to the same price on Amazon).

My Soleus 7000 only lasted about 2 years before I got an E04 message on the display, which Soleus told me means the compressor is out of Freon and is not repairable. Prior to the E04 message the unit worked great. I live in Central Florida and used it to cool down a den which it did fairly quickly. I ran the unit almost every day between May and October. I guess I got my use out of it, but would have expected it to last more than 24 months before shutting down.

If only there had been reviews of this portable when I bought it 3 years ago. I took a chance. I thought it was something I was doing wrong, or the unit was defective, as I discovered right away that it leaks from underneath quite a bit, enough to soak several towels in an hour in humid weather. But I had destroyed the box to get it out, it weighs a lot, it does cool well, and returning it didn't seem like an option . If I had the inclination I could put it up on a homemade stand of some sort so a pan, like a cake or bread pan maybe, would fit under it, there is no space under it for anything but a piddle pad as it is. But I 'm going to give it away now that I got small ac's for the bedroom and living room windows. Don't buy this.
